摘要
利用一阶线性电路暂态分折的三要素法来分折和建立电力拖动系统的数学模型。利用"三要素"法对直流拖动系统或交流拖动系统过渡过程分折和建模实践,可以消除烦琐的数学运算,并且具有一定的工程计算的准确性和应用性。
In this article "three essential factors"of transitional first order linear circuit is used to analyze and establishment the mathematical model of electric power drive.The trouble of mathematics operation can be eliminated by the use of"three essential factors"to analyze and establish the module of DC power drive system or AC power drive system.And has certain accuracy and using in the engineering calculation field.
